PETER HITCHENS: Lets face it...we're a small, debt-ridden country nobody cares about
DailyMail.com ^ | 11/17/2018 | Peter Hitchens

Posted on 11/18/2018 5:55:34 AM PST by Nextrush

For far too long we in this country have thought we were richer, more powerful and, in general, better than we actually are. Now we find out the hard truth, exposed in all its gloomy detail by the EU talks. Will we learn the necessary lesson, or will we prefer our precious illusions?

I can just remember in the mists of my childhood memory the 1956 Suez crisis, the feeling of panic and humiliation in the air.

In that year, too many of us continued to imagine we were more important than we were. The Americans wasted no time in letting us know that we no longer ruled the waves, harassing our ships at sea and threatening us with bankruptcy on the world markets.

The sense of decline was especially strong in our house, since my father was a Naval officer.....

Then came the Profumo affair. A once-respected governing class was caught with its trousers down....

Thatcherism, much misunderstood and over-rated at the time, did little to reverse the underlying decline....

... Clinton took the side of the Provisional IRA against Britain, his supposed closest democratic ally, and forced us to give in to terror.....

What sort of deal did you think such a nation could get from our giant German-dominated neighbor? I'd hoped to shake loose from the frightful European Arrest Warrant but nobody seems to have asked for that, thanks to our weird obsession with trade over all else...

But this is what we can get and if we do not take it, then it will be Suez all over again-a few brief weeks of heady fantasy, and many long hard years paying the bill for our illusions.
